Transaction 3dcf39e281056ac51aaf0150aee50fec8764304996edd116921fd26ccbe8695c

1 Input
2 Outputs
  • 3dcf39e281056ac51aaf0150aee50fec8764304996edd116921fd26ccbe8695c:0
  • value  996982
    address  3LVU7a2agMR3dLWo2LmRocVQ3ZSQbkY5k8
  • 3dcf39e281056ac51aaf0150aee50fec8764304996edd116921fd26ccbe8695c:1
  • value  99000000
    address  3BCwjQUupodThMF2TMBdRjGisoUVzryV72